A number of unnamed Pentagon officials have expressed interest in delivering a “decapitation strike” to the Kremlin. In an interview with TASS, Russian Foreign Minister Sergei Lavrov stated that such words constitute a threat to physically eliminate the Russian president.
Lavrov stated, “If someone has such notions, they should carefully consider the probable repercussions of their actions.”
Previously, the Russian embassy in Washington drew attention to a “crazy” option of the American command — a so-called decapitation blow against the Russian military and political leadership.
“I would like to assume that such ludicrous arguments do not represent the official stance of the United States Department of Defense. Otherwise, the globe has approached a perilous threshold, and Caribbean Crisis 2.0 looms on the horizon. Diplomats stated that they assume Washington is aware of the increasing nature of such dangerous language.
